首页 专利交易 科技果 科技人才 科技服务 商标交易 会员权益 IP管家助手 需求市场 关于龙图腾
 /  免费注册
到顶部 到底部
清空 搜索

基于非最大纠缠GHZ态实现双方量子密钥协商的方法 

买专利卖专利找龙图腾,真高效! 查专利查商标用IPTOP,全免费!专利年费监控用IP管家,真方便!

申请/专利权人:苏州大学

摘要:本发明涉及量子保密通信技术领域,尤其是指一种基于非最大纠缠GHZ态实现双方量子密钥协商的方法。所述方法分为Alice和Bob两个用户,其中Alice制备2L个非最大纠缠的GHZ态,以其两两纠缠态作为粒子源,并将所有非最大GHZ态粒子分组为s1和s2,将s2发送给Bob。Alice与Bob分别对s1和s2进行Bell测量,则得到一个共同的二进制序列M。Alice对s1进行操作后发送给Bob,Bob对M进行计算并公布结果。最后Bob测量Alice操作后的s1,Alice接收Bob的计算结果,双方得到最终的共享密钥K。所述方法具有良好的安全性,并且拥有较高的量子位效率,还可以对抗集体噪声。

主权项:1.一种基于非最大纠缠GHZ态实现双方量子密钥协商的方法,有两个用户Alice和Bob参与量子密钥协商,且两者都通过了网络中心服务器的身份认证,每个用户分别拥有长为2L比特的密钥,对应的密钥为KA和KB,其特征在于,具体步骤包括:步骤一、参与者Alice与参与者Bob各自生成两位密钥与其中j=1,2,3,…,L,构成密钥序列KA和KB;参与者Alice制备2L个非最大纠缠的GHZ态粒子对并以作为粒子源,其中i=1,2,3,…,L;将这些粒子分为两个序列s1={A1,A2,A3,…,A2L},s2={B1,C1,B2,C2,B3,C3,…,B2L,C2L},即序列s1包含所有GHZ态的第一个粒子,序列s2包含所有GHZ态的第二和第三个粒子;步骤二、参与者Alice将序列s1留在本地,然后将足够多的诱骗光子随机插入到序列s2中,生成序列并记录插入的诱骗光子的位置及状态;步骤三、参与者Alice将得到的序列发送给参与者Bob,在参与者Bob确认接收到序列后,参与者Alice宣布诱骗光子的位置以及相应的测量基;步骤四、参与者Bob根据参与者Alice宣布的诱骗光子的位置以及相应的测量基,对接收到的序列进行测量,并将测量结果告知参与者Alice;通过将测量结果与诱骗光子的初始状态进行比较,参与者Alice得到错误率;如果测量结果错误率小于给定阈值,表示没有窃听者,将执行步骤五;否则,将放弃前面的所有操作,重新执行步骤一;步骤五、参与者Bob去除中的诱骗光子,重新得到序列s2;参与者Bob对序列s2进行Bell测量,并对测量结果进行编码,得到长度为2L比特的二进制序列MB;该编码规则为:当BiCi粒子的测量结果为|00+|11或|00-|11,Bi+LCi+L粒子的测量结果失败时,标记为失败;当BiCi粒子和Bi+LCi+L粒子的测量结果都为|01+|10,或BiCi粒子和Bi+LCi+L粒子的测量结果都为|01-|10时,记为10;当BiCi粒子的测量结果为|01+|10且Bi+LCi+L粒子的测量结果为|01-|10,或BiCi粒子的测量结果为|01-|10且Bi+LCi+L粒子的测量结果为|01+|10时,记为11;同时,参与者Alice对序列s1进行Bell测量,并对测量结果进行编码,表示为序列MA;将序列s1测量坍缩后记为s′1;该编码规则为:当测量结果为|00+|11或|11-|11时,标记为失败;当测量结果为|01+|10时,记为10;当测量结果为|01-|10时,记为11;有序列MA=MB,记为序列M,并标记出序列中测量失败的位置,则参与者Alice和参与者Bob得到一个仅有双方拥有且共享的序列M,其中Mj={10,11},且参与者Bob根据序列MB得知参与者Alice的测量结果;步骤六、参与者Alice根据自己的密钥对序列s′1进行Pauli操作,得到序列s′3;该Pauli操作为:当时,进行I操作;当时,进行X操作;当时,进行Z操作;当时,进行iY操作;其中I操作表示为X操作表示为Z操作表示为iY操作表示为iY=|01|-|10|=步骤七、参与者Alice在序列s′3中随机插入足够多的诱骗光子,得到序列与步骤三、四相同,参与者Alice将序列发送给参与者Bob并进行窃听检测;若错误率低于阈值,则将诱骗光子去除,恢复序列s′3并继续执行步骤八;若错误率高于阈值,则终止;步骤八、参与者Bob对序列s′3进行Bell测量并编码,得到序列P;此时序列P在序列M测量成功的位置的值等于该编码规则为:当测量结果为|00+|11时,Pj记为00;当测量结果为|11-|11时,Pj记为01;当测量结果为|01+|10时,Pj记为10;当测量结果为|01-|10时,Pj记为11;步骤九、参与者Bob将序列KB、M及P中与序列M测量错误对应位置的Mj及Pj去掉,得到序列K′B、M′及P′,同时参与者Alice将序列KA中与序列M测量错误对应位置的去掉,得到K′A;参与者Bob得到共享密钥步骤十、参与者Bob公布的值,参与者Alice根据参与者Bob公布的值,得到共享密钥最终的共享密钥

全文数据:

权利要求:

百度查询: 苏州大学 基于非最大纠缠GHZ态实现双方量子密钥协商的方法

免责声明
1、本报告根据公开、合法渠道获得相关数据和信息,力求客观、公正,但并不保证数据的最终完整性和准确性。
2、报告中的分析和结论仅反映本公司于发布本报告当日的职业理解,仅供参考使用,不能作为本公司承担任何法律责任的依据或者凭证。